COKING COAL DAILY: Prices diverge in fob, cfr markets

July 02, 2021 / www.metalbulletin.com / Article Link

Coking coal prices diverged on Thursday July 1, with cfr prices reversing amid expectations of easing domestic supply tightness in July and fob prices continuing to increase due to restocking demand, sources told Fastmarkets.

Fastmarkets indices
Premium hard coking coal, fob DBCT: $191.80 per tonne, up $1.48 per tonne
Premium hard coking coal, cfr Jingtang: $306.59 per tonne, down $0.94 per tonne
Hard coking coal, fob DBCT: $163.42 per tonne, unchanged
Hard coking coal, cfr Jingtang: $266.21 per tonne, down $1.61 per tonne
Most market participants adopted a wait-and-see approach to the seaborne coking coal market on Thursday July 1, which is the 100th anniversary of the Chinese Communist Party.
